Format of the IFSC Code INDB0000921
The format of the IFSC Code for banks, including Indusind Bank, follows an 11-character structure:
AAAA0CCCCCC
Here's the breakdown:
- First 4 characters (AAAA): Show the bank code. For Indusind Bank, these letters represent the bank's short name.
- 5th character: Is always zero and is kept for future use.
- Last 6 characters (CCCCCC): Represent the specific branch code assigned to branches such as Delhi Hub in Delhi.

How to Use IFSC Code INDB0000921 for Online Transfers?
Once you have the IFSC Code INDB0000921 for the Delhi Hub branch of Indusind Bank in Delhi, you can initiate your fund transfers using any digital method:
NEFT
Add the beneficiary's name, account number, and IFSC Code INDB0000921. The transfer is completed in batches. It is useful for both personal and business payments.
RTGS
Used for payments over ₹2 lakh. Real-time settlement using the IFSC Code of the recipient branch.
IMPS
Instant 24×7 transfers. Requires the recipient's account details and Indusind Bank IFSC Code INDB0000921.
No matter which payment method you use, the IFSC Code must be correct. If you enter the wrong IFSC Code for the Indusind Bank Delhi Hub in Delhi, your payment can get delayed or might not go through at all.
